The group also offers certain niche products and services in the UK and India. Listed on the Johannesburg Stock Exchange (JSE) and the Namibian Stock Exchange (NSX), FirstRand Limited is the largest financial institution by market capitalisation in Africa. The group follows a multi‑branding approach. Its portfolio of financial services businesses includes FNB, RMB, WesBank, Ashburton Investments, Aldermore, MotoNovo and DirectAxis. Many are leaders in their respective segments and markets, offering transactional, lending, investment and insurance products and services. The FirstRand Corporate Centre houses many of the critical functions required by a large and complex financial services group. The group’s track record of delivering superior returns to shareholders has been achieved through a combination of organic growth, acquisitions, innovation and the creation of completely new businesses.
